FRATERNAL ORDER OF EAGLES AERIE 1744, founded in 1908, is a small nonprofit in the Mutual Benefit sector that reported $424K in total revenue in fiscal year 2024. Revenue grew 13% year-over-year, indicating healthy expansion.

Mission

COMMUNITY SUPPORT INCLUDING PROVIDING SCHOLARSHIP FUNDS FOR STEVENSON HIGH SCHOOL GRADUATES, PROVIDING SUPPORT FOR HIGH SCHOOL MUSIC PROGRAM AND OTHER LOCAL COMMUNITY SUPPORT.
